AV Blocks

3/10/2017

0 Comments

 
Amal Mattu gives us a very simple way to distinguish the type of advanced AV block by looking at the PR intervals.
  • PR interval gradually increasing = Mobitz I
  • PR interval fixed = Mobitz II
  • PR interval appears random = 3rd Degree Block

Heart Block

1/24/2017

0 Comments

 
Dr. Mattu walks us through a three step method to make identifying heart blocks easy. Just ask three qestions
1) What is the atrium doing? (regular, irregular rate?)
2) What is the ventricle doing? (morphology and thus location? rate?)
3) How are the two related? (Look at PR interval, is it regular? long then dropped QRS, longer, longer then drop? or randomly related? 1st, 2nd, 3rd degree blocks).
